Rear Panel

1
2
1.
Aux Input 1: Connect a line-level device, such as a CD player, laptop, smartphone, or media device, to
this 1/8" (3.5 mm) input.
2.
Aux Input 2: Connect a line-level device, such as a CD player, tablet, smartphone, or media device to
these coaxial inputs.
3.
USB Ports: Both USB ports are capable of 2.1A charging. The top USB port also supports USB flash
drive playback of WAV, MP3, and WMA files.
4.
SD Card Slot: Connect a SD card here to play your WAV, MP3, and WMA files.
5.
XLR+1/4": Connect dynamic microphones to these mic inputs.
6.
Mic/Line Switch: Press this switch in to have the gain set for mic level sources. Have the switch in the
outward position for line-level sources.
7.
Line Output: Connect this 1/4" TRS (6.35 mm) output to another Audio Commander.
8.
Wireless Receivers: Select the wireless mic channel using the Up/Down buttons and press the Set
button to link the channel to the wireless mic. See
details.
Power Input: Connect the included power cable here.
9.
Energy Saving Mode: Audio Commander will enter a low-power "sleep" mode after 60 minutes if no
Bluetooth music or audio input source is playing through it. To resume normal operation, press any
button.
10. Power Switch: Adjust this switch to power Audio Commander on/off.
